

Clarence was a very caring and loving man with a heart of gold. He never met a stranger and enjoyed putting a smile on everyone’s face. Clarence was very driven and had an amazing work ethic and this was evident throughout his life. Clarence was always very active and in his spare time, he enjoyed being outside tending to his vegetable and flower gardens. Clarence was known to have a green thumb and always had beautiful flowers.
On July 3, 1959 he married the love of his life, Peggy Hallford Cravey, and they spent the next sixty-three years together. Clarence spent thirty years working for Delta Airlines before retiring. Thereafter, he filled his time working at IBM as a contractor for seven years. In his younger years, Clarence also served in the United States Navy.
Clarence was a man of God and a devout Christian. As a Pastor, he founded and built Calvary Assembly of God in Hampton, Georgia, as well as moving and building a new Cordele Assembly of God, now known as New Covenant Assembly of God, in Cordele, Georgia. Clarence also pastored many churches such as Mount Carmel Assembly of God, Barnesville Assembly of God and Tallapoosa Assembly of God. Clarence was known by many and will deeply be missed.
